Find the Pumpkin


Different coloured pumpkins are drawn and cut. Funny faces are drawn on them and on the back different numbers are written. They are then hid. The players have to find the pumpkins. The player with the highest score is the winner.

YOU WILL NEED:

-10 pieces of white paper
-5 pieces of yellow paper
-5 pieces of orange paper
-a crayon
-scissors
 

  1. Draw ten white pumpkins, five yellow pumpkins and five orange pumpkins.
  2. Cut out all the pumpkins.
  3. Draw a funny face on each pumpkin.
  4. Write the number 1 on the backs of the white pumpkins.
  5. Write the number 5 on the backs of the yellow pumpkins.
  6. Write the number 10 on the backs of the orange pumpkins.
  7. Hide the pumpkins.
  8. When your friends come, tell them to find as many pumpkins as they can before you say "Stop!"
  9. Have your friends add up the numbers on the pumpkins they found.
  10. The person with the most points wins.
